Heavy rainfall has plunged several areas in Cebu into a state of emergency, with residents making desperate pleas for rescue as floodwaters continue to rise. The relentless downpour has transformed streets into raging rivers, leaving many families trapped in their homes.
Desperate Calls for Help
Across affected communities, residents have taken to social media and emergency channels to call for immediate assistance. Many report being stranded on rooftops and upper floors of their homes as water levels reached alarming heights.
"We need help now!" one resident pleaded in a viral social media post. "The water is already at our second floor and we have children here who need to be evacuated."
Emergency Response Efforts
Local disaster response teams have been working around the clock to reach affected areas. However, the rapid rise of floodwaters and strong currents have made rescue operations challenging in many locations.
Rescue personnel are utilizing boats and other floating devices to reach stranded residents, prioritizing the elderly, children, and individuals with medical conditions.

Community Solidarity Amid Crisis
Despite the dire situation, stories of community support have emerged. Neighbors are helping each other secure safe passage to higher ground, while local businesses have opened their doors to provide temporary shelter.
"We're doing everything we can to help our fellow Cebuanos," shared one volunteer. "In times like these, we must stand together as a community."
Authorities continue to monitor the situation closely and advise residents in low-lying areas to remain vigilant as more rainfall is expected in the coming hours.
